Sneha and Gayle's blushing moment at the IPL!

Sneha Wagh aka Ratan of Star Plus' Veera shares her experience of presenting the 'Nayi Soch' Award to Chris Gayle at the IPL…

Sneha Wagh who plays Ratan in Beyond Dreams' Veera, recently had a great experience during at the ongoing IPL. Sneha is a cricket fan and she likes to follow the matches. Sneha Wagh witnessed the IPL match between RCB and Rajasthan Royals which was played on 20th and later on, she presented the Nayi Soch Award. 

TellyBuzz spoke to Sneha Wagh about her experience in the IPL and about her interest in cricket. Speaking on the same, she said, "I follow cricket as a game. Being an Indian and a Mumbaikar, I am a cricket fan. However, I cannot follow IPL that much because of my hectic schedule. So this was definitely a great experience for me. I have been to Mohali, Chandigarh and Bangalore and I will again be travelling to Chennai on 28th April."

When asked about her favorite cricketer and her experience about meeting them, Sneha said, "There is nothing called favorite; I like all of them. I was extremely happy to meet Rahul Dravid and Chris Gayle. There was so much of security around that one can barely meet the cricketers unless you are the IPL owner or part of the committee. Rahul Dravid is a thorough gentleman and very respectful and that is why people love him so much. Chris Gayle is so tall and huge that I felt as though I was looking at the 'Burj Khalifa' in Dubai."

Sneha further added, "I also had a very brief and fun filled conversation with him while giving the 'Nayi Soch Award.' After giving away the trophy, I jokingly asked him if he wanted the cheque too and he was like 'ya.' I was completely flattered the moment he said 'beautiful.' I was like 'wow Chris Gayle said I was beautiful.' I have a picture of us together where we both are actually blushing."

Did Sneha get mobbed at the places she went? Getting a positive reply from Sneha's side, we heard from her, "Yes, in Mohali people were constantly coming up to me and clicking pictures. Finally the bouncers had to intervene and move them away."

"It's their love for the show and Ratan which is always very overwhelming," concludes Sneha.

TOI : Kids make prime time TRPs soar

Amrita Mulchandani, TNN | Apr 19, 2013, 12.00 AM IST

Kids make prime time TRPs soar
Bhavesh Balchandani in Veera
While many established names on TV are struggling to pull a show on their own, kids are raking in the TRPs. Be it reality, mythology or fiction, irrespective of the format of the show, kids are ruling the charts. And the audience sure doesn't mind seeing the little ones weaving an adorable world on screen through their innocent charm. 

Sample this: be it mythologicals like Jai Jai Jai Bajrangbali (Raj Bhanushali as Bal Hanuman),Devon Ke Dev Mahadev, (Sadhil Kapoor as Ganpati), or fictional shows like Taarak Mehta Ka Ooltah Chashmah (Bhavya Gandhi as Tappu), Ek Veer Ki Ardaas — Veera (Hrishita Oja as Veera and Bhavesh Balchandani as Ranvijay), Bade Acche Laggte Hai (Amrita Mukherjee as Pihu), fantasy show Baal Veer (Dev Doshi as Baal Veer) and reality shows like India's Best Dramebaaz and Indian Idol Junior are focusing on the child power. 

The focus is surely on the kids, but do they really make a difference in the TRP game? "Kids are a big factor for attracting audiences," says producer Shiv Sagar of Jai Jai Jai Bajrangbali. He adds, "They are natural in expressing themselves and I think that works with the audience. Children have been at the center of efforts to create an audience connect in films as well as in commercials for a long time. TV is all about having a habit to watch a show regularly and in most cases, the kid becomes a habit for the audience, so TRPs shoot up." 

"Kids attract attention because they add freshness to the show. Since TV viewership mainly comprise women, kids never fail to create an instant connect. But I feel kids should be introduced as a part of the story and should not stand out like a sore thumb. In India, any family story on small screen is incomplete without kids," says producer-writer Asit Modi of Taarak Mehta Ka Ooltah Chashmah

And it's not just daily soaps, TV commercials have been riding on child power for years. While depending completely on a child artist is a risk, showmakers seem to be fine with it. "We wanted to show the life of Bal Hanuman which no one has explored so far and had planned to keep the track for three months. But since the response was tremendous we continued with it. Shooting with a child is not easy, but we decided to take the risk and it has proved to fruitful," says Shiv Sagar.
Some showmakers feel the content that is the king. "Kids have an emotional connect with audiences. Though there is no clear cut formula to garner ratings, what works is honest storytelling and believable characters. Younger actors sure bring some novelty with them," says producer Yash Patnaik of Ek Veer Ki Ardaas — Veera. 

And in between all this hoopla about the TRPs and the competition, kids on TV are having a good time. Amrita Mukherjee, who plays the role of Pihu in Bade Ache Lagte Hai loves all the affection and attention she gets. "I love being with Sakshi aunty, Ram uncle and Sameer uncle. I enjoy acting a lot. My entire unit pampers me a lot. Initially, there was a problem when my school mates and other people would come to click pictures with me, but now everything is settled," says Amrita.
It seems, these kids will never cease to garner attention and if they can fetch the TRPs, then the channels/producers can enjoy their adorable antics and innocent endeavours with renewed enthusiasm too!

I was never a hunk: Kapil Nirmal

Thanks to his sculpted body and macho looks, Kapil Nirmal is quite popular among girls, but the actor clarifies that he is not aiming to become a small screen hunk.

Thanks to his sculpted body and macho looks, Kapil Nirmal is quite popular among girls, but the actor clarifies that he is not aiming to become a small screen hunk.

"I was never a hunk. I can never expect myself to be one. I was a normal simple guy. I just want to be myself and obviously want to do lead characters," said Kapil, who was here for the shooting of Star Plus' show "Ek Veer Ki Ardaas...Veera". And he was mobbed by his female fans.

The 32-year-old is seen as Nihal Singh in "Ek Veer Ki Ardaas...Veera", who comes to a village to get rid of a sin that he did in the past.

The show is enjoying a good TRP right now and the actor feels if audience starts predicting the story of any TV show, it is a good news for makers.

"If people are predicting the storyline that means they are watching the show and it is a good thing. The moment people would stop doing that, it would mean that they have lost interest in it," Kapil, who made his debut with "Shakira", told IANS.

He was last seen playing the role of a Haryanvi guy in "Na Aana Is Des Laado", which was also set in the backdrop of a village. However, the actor feels his role in the two shows are very different.

"'Veera...' and 'Na aana...' are two different shows with different genres. That was more of action and this is more of drama. My looks were also different," said Kapil.

The actor hails from Jaipur and after doing graduation in commerce, he took up a marketing job, but says "acting was always on my mind".

Kapil also has his eyes set on Bollywood and said it will happen "very soon".

"I want to do it. If god will permit, I will soon do something good. Bollywood will happen for sure," he said.
